Check the Finish. The exterior of the piece should be a uniform color, except for variations that would naturally occur through exposure to the elements and use. Surface blemishes and scars are acceptable, but burn marks can�t be taken out or painted over without cutting out that section of wood, so avoid buying antiques with a burn unless you can live with it. A piece of furniture costing more than $300 shouldn�t have any visible nails; their presence may be signs of a sloppy repair job.

Browse through antique stores and flea markets or visit auctions. Don't make impulse buys. If you're unsure about a piece, don't buy it on a whim. Learn to trust your instinct. Many old hands at collecting simply "know" when a piece is good or bad. At least in the beginning, stay away from buying online. Until you are more knowledgeable about your area of interest, it's simply too easy to be "taken."

Rearrange lamps and decorative items on wooden tabletops. If you don't, exposed wood will lighten and unexposed wood will remain dark after time.
